Default Awesome! I scored a 2.55 pulley.

Now that I am buying a 2.55", I am gonna be putting a new cat on, and getting colder plugs. What plugs are recommended and what gap? And also, anyone within Ohio, IN, PA, or MI with a scantool? If so, Maybe I can drop by at your house and we can take a look at the KR before installing the pulley?

One heat range colder. I suggest NGK TR-55 V-Power plugs at .055".

Carefully inspect your exhaust manifolds for cracks and check your fuel pressure before installing the pulley. A high-flow Cat may also be necessary.

You MUST check your fuel pressure and scan.
